构建插件 VS MSVC - Sc-Softs/CornerstoneSDK GitHub Wiki

执行上方菜单中的 生成->生成 CornerstoneSDK(Ctrl+B) 来构建插件。

提示:

生成的中间文件在 build/ 目录下,生成的插件文件在 out/ 目录下。

🎉你的插件应该已经构建出来了!(编译错误的话不算)

如果要修改插件文件名,请在 CornerstoneSDK 属性页->配置属性->常规 中修改 目标文件名(注意在上方选择 配置->所有配置)。执行上方菜单中的 生成->清理 CornerstoneSDK 就可以清理中间文件和生成的插件。

提示:

编译时 Visual Studio 会自动按需清理,无需手动清理。

推荐使用 Debug 配置来生成易于调试的插件,使用 Release 配置来生成用于发布的插件。

注意:

Debug 配置生成的插件最大可能是 Release 配置生成的插件的约 40 倍体积,速度也会略微降低,但 Release 配置生成的插件几乎无法用于调试。

如果要使用其他 C++ 源文件,请 右键单击 Plugin 筛选器->添加->新建项/现有项。如有必要也可以在 CornerstoneSDK 属性页->配置属性->生成事件->生成后事件 中加上复制编译后的插件到插件安装目录的命令(注意在上方选择 配置->所有配置)。